Overview

The University of Wyoming offers a Master of Science in Agricultural Economics/Environment and Natural Resources through its College of Agriculture and Natural Resources. This program lasts for 18 months and has a tuition fee of $19,668. To apply for this program, students need to show their English language skills, which can be done by taking the TOEFL test. The minimum requirement for graduation to be considered for admission is a CGP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ale.

    Eligibility Criteria

    12th Grade

    There is no specific cutoff mentioned for 12th-grade requirements.

    Graduation

    Applicants must have a bachelor's degree from an accredited school with a minimum GPA of 3.0 on a scale where A equals 4.0. They should have completed at least one course in calculus, statistics or econometrics, and intermediate microeconomic theory. If they have not completed these courses, they may need to take them without earning graduate credit.
